Overview:

Accountant I Credit Union is responsible for providing financial services to members of the credit union. This includes managing accounts, processing payments, and providing financial advice. They must be knowledgeable about the credit union’s policies and procedures, as well as the regulations and laws that govern the credit union industry.

What is Accountant I Credit Union Job Skills Required?

• Knowledge of financial regulations and laws
• Knowledge of accounting principles and practices
• Ability to analyze financial data
• Ability to prepare financial reports
• Excellent customer service skills
• Ability to work with members to ensure their financial needs are met
• Ability to work independently and as part of a team
• Excellent communication and interpersonal skills

What is Accountant I Credit Union Job Qualifications?

•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, or related field
• At least two years of experience in a financial institution
• Certified Public Accountant (CPA) certification preferred
• Knowledge of credit union operations and procedures
